Stefanini is looking for a Multimedia Designer (Dearborn, MI) For quick apply, please reach out to Parul Singh at 248-582-6481/parul.singh@stefanini.com Multimedia Designer to develop critical learning solutions and support of global learning initiatives. This includes identifying and implementing internal training solutions to upskill/reskill the workforce and identifying innovative solutions in training development. The position will also evaluate, summarize and develop key learning metrics. It requires expertise in Instructional Systems Design (ISD) models, practical graphic design, and video production experience, working with Subject Matter Experts/Project Teams/Business Partners, and strategic and critical thinking Responsibilities Work with stakeholders to evaluate existing interventions, analyze learning needs, identify learning objectives, and ensure learning meets customer expectations Design and maintain end-to-end learning experiences, and mechanisms for feedback, evaluation, and improvement Plan, design, develop, implement, and evaluate human-centered, learner-focused experiences for employees while leveraging online learning platforms Provide subject matter expertise on instructional design theory, training implementation, and effective learning strategies Manage projects using appropriate standards including needs, chartering, scoping, performance consulting, testing, and deployment Develop and author Web-based, Virtual Classroom, and Instructor-led training courses and modify existing materials and courses as needed, ensuring training meets accepted quality standards Experience Required 5+ years of experience in course development tools such as Adobe Captivate, Adobe Creative Suite, Camtasia Experience with storyboarding, video scripting, recording, video and audio editing, music selection, sound effects, and producing Examples include videos developed using Camtasia, Premiere, or After Effects software 5+ years' experience in the design and development of adult technical learning, both Web-based and Instructor-Led 2+ years of experience in Project Management Ability to work well in a team environment using strong inter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ills Strong analysis and design skills with an emphasis on future-focused learning experiences Ability to quickly learn and adopt new technology, tools, and methods Experience Preferred 2+ years of experience in automotive-related learning and development Familiarity with modern Learning Management Systems such as Xyleme Learning Content Management System, SABA Learning Management System, and Learning Experience Platforms such as Degreed Experience in web and graphic design tools for the development of multimedia content including brochures, marketing flyers, high visibility communication content in PowerPoint, Word, Adobe Creative Cloud software, and other tools Fluency in MS Office Suite of Applications Education Required Bachelor's Degree in Educational/Instructional Technology, Instructional Systems Design, or in Audio-Visual Production, video production, and multimedia operation and development or related degree Education Preferred Master's Degree in Educational/Instructional Technology, Instructional Systems Design, or related degree •Listed salary ranges may vary based on experience, qualifications, and local market.
